If 3 J of work are needed to stretch a spring from 11 cm to 13 cm and 5 J are needed to stretch it from 13 cm to 15 cm, what is the natural length of the spring?
what 3 J & 5 J mean?
J=joule for more information, read https://en.wikipedia.org/wiki/Joule Here the two unknowns are 1. spring constant, k (stiffness of spring) 2. natural length, L The standard relation between stretching and work done (in joules) is W(x1,x2)=(k/2)(L+x2)^2-k(L+x1)^2 where the string is stretched from L+x1 to L+x2. L=natural of spring (m) W=work done (J) k=spring constant (J/m) |dw:1475595594302:dw| Two equations can be formed, one for each case/observation: 3=(k/2)((L+0.13)^2-(L+0.11)^2) 5=(k/2)((L+0.15)^2-(L+0.13)^2) Solve the system of equations and find k and L.
